What is a Penthouse?
A penthouse is the most exclusive and spacious apartment in a building, typically situated on the highest floor with panoramic views of the city or skyline. Often featuring open-concept layouts, high ceilings, upscale finishes, and private terraces, penthouses blend luxury with modern design. While definitions vary, most agree: a penthouse is the ultimate symbol of prestige, status, and elevated urban living.

Key Features of a Penthouse
🔹 Prime Location & Elevated Views – Perched high above the city, penthouses boast unobstructed vistas of streets, landmarks, and sunsets.
🔹 Spacious, Open Layouts – Mill-Flat or semi-open floor plans with high ceilings and generous square footage for maximum comfort.
🔹 Luxury Finishes – Premium materials like marble, quartz, and custom cabinetry, often paired with smart home technology.
🔹 Prime Amenities – Some developments include private lounges, cinemas, fitness centers, pools, and concierge services.
🔹 Exclusive Access – Elevated security, secure entrances, and bespoke concierge offerings ensure privacy and convenience.
